Replacement Of F071135 Hydraulic Cylinder

The Replacement Of F071135 Hydraulic Cylinder is a crucial component used in various hydraulic systems. It is designed to provide reliable and efficient performance, ensuring the smooth operation of equipment. With a weight of 65 lb, a height of 3 in, a width of 4.75 in, and a length of 71 in, this hydraulic cylinder is suitable for the following models: 1710D, 1711D, 1910E, 1910G, and CF8.

The Replacement Of F071135 Hydraulic Cylinder is a vital part of hydraulic systems. It is responsible for converting hydraulic power into mechanical force, allowing the equipment to perform various tasks. By extending and retracting the piston rod, the hydraulic cylinder generates linear motion, enabling precise control and movement in machinery operations.

Diagnosi dei guasti e problemi comuni

Identifying and diagnosing potential faults in the hydraulic cylinder is essential for efficient troubleshooting. Here are some common issues:

1. Perdita

One common problem is hydraulic fluid leakage, which can be caused by worn seals or damaged components.

2. Cylinder Misalignment

If the hydraulic cylinder is misaligned, it can cause uneven wear and poor performance. Proper alignment is necessary for optimal operation.

3. Insufficient Pressure

Inadequate hydraulic pressure can result from pump or valve malfunctions, leading to decreased cylinder performance. Thorough diagnosis is required to identify the root cause.
